Technical field
The present invention relates to water purifier structure technical field, more particularly to a kind of preventing water leakage self-locking filter core.
Background technology
At present, water purifier is at home using popularization has been compared, and water purifier can be to impurity in water and caused by hydraulic pipeline Depth-type filtration is carried out, more clean domestic water is provided for people, so as to preferably protect in the health of user, water purifier Portion usually requires to can be only achieved preferable clean-up effect using a variety of cartridge combinations, multistage filtering, and filter core is the core of water purifier Part, filter core is used as a kind of consumptive material, using after a period of time, it is necessary to be changed to it.
Existing water purifier is generally linked together filter cores at different levels by quick union and connection flexible pipe, this kind of structure type The defect of water purifier be between filter cores at different levels to be attached with substantial amounts of flexible pipe and joint, when needing to indivedual filter cores When being changed, the dismounting very complicated of flexible pipe and joint;Importantly, being easy to occur between flexible pipe, joint and filter core The phenomenons such as leak.
Also the water purification catridge with sealing device is had in existing water purifier, such as U of patent CN 201482290 are disclosed A kind of quick-connected filter element structure for purifier, the water purifier includes connector and filter element device, is set on connector Automatic sealing device, to there is the situation of leak when preventing and changing filter core, can facilitate user's self-changeable.But this kind of filter core Complex structural designs, volume is larger, is unfavorable for the integral layout inside water purifier, especially in becoming that the products such as water purifier are minimized Under gesture, this filter cartridge construction can not increasingly meet the market demand.

Embodiment
Referring to figs. 1 to Fig. 3, a kind of preventing water leakage self-locking filter core of the invention, including filter cylinder 10 and the set in filter cylinder 10 Cylinder 20, has an annular flow inner chamber 30 between filter cylinder 10 and sleeve 20, the top of sleeve 20 have connection annular flow inner chamber 30 with The through hole of the inner chamber of sleeve 20, the bottom center of sleeve 20 stretches out to form annular inner wall 21, and the bottom center of filter cylinder 10 stretches out Annular outer wall 11 is formed, the gap between annular outer wall 11 and annular inner wall 21 constitutes the ring being connected with annular flow inner chamber 30 Shape cavity 12, annular inner wall 21 constitutes the cylindrical cavity 22 with the intracavity inter-connection of sleeve 20, provided with elasticity in toroidal cavity 12 The first containment member 40 of toroidal cavity 12 is blocked, the second sealing provided with elasticity closure cylindrical cavity 12 in cylindrical cavity 12 Component 50.
In the present embodiment, toroidal cavity 12 as filter core water inlet, cylindrical cavity 12 as filter core delivery port, set Cylinder 20 enters in annular flow inner chamber 30 built with water purification filter material, water through toroidal cavity 12, in the through hole by the top of sleeve 20 Flow into the inner chamber of sleeve 20 to be purified, then flowed outwardly through cylindrical cavity 12.
Filter core of the present invention with the base engagement of circulation duct with using, when filter core is plugged on base, in filter core bottom The first containment member 40 and the second containment member 50 is moved inward in the presence of external structure so that toroidal cavity 12 and post Shape cavity 12 is communicated with the circulation duct in base.
Specifically, the first containment member 40 includes closure ring 41 and (the first back-moving spring 42, and closure ring 41 is sleeved on annular It is reciprocally moveable on inwall 21, (the first back-moving spring 42 is sleeved on outside annular inner wall 21 and in closure ring 41 and the bottom of sleeve 20 End, the madial wall of annular outer wall 11 is stepped construction, wherein, radially-inwardly shrink and formed in the middle part of the madial wall of annular outer wall 11 One section of inclined-plane 43, the inner sidewall upper portion of annular outer wall 11 and bottom are flat segments, and the outer sidewall diameter of closure ring 41 is equal to or omited Flange is kept out provided with radially inwardly projecting first in the small madial wall lower diameter in annular outer wall 11, the bottom of annular outer wall 11 44, the first internal diameter for keeping out flange 44 is less than the outer sidewall diameter of closure ring 41, outwards deviates from so as to limit closure ring 41, in envelope The lateral wall of blocking ring 41 is embedded with sealing ring, the place relative with the madial wall bottom of annular outer wall 11 on the lateral wall of annular inner wall 21 It is embedded with sealing ring.
Under the effect of no external structure, (the first back-moving spring 42 promotes closure ring 41 to be moved to annular outer wall by elastic force Between 11 madial wall bottom and annular inner wall 21, toroidal cavity 12 is blocked by closure ring 41 and sealing ring.When depositing In the effect of external structure, closure ring 41 is promoted and overcomes the elastic force of (the first back-moving spring 42 to move inward, now annular Cavity 12 is communicated with outside.
The motion bar 51 that second containment member 50 includes plugging block, self-styled sprue is extended centrally out, and the second reset bullet Spring 52, the top of annular inner wall 21 extends radially inwardly to form fixed flange 23, and the fixed center of flange 23 has in connection sleeve 20 The runner of chamber and cylindrical cavity 22, the insertion runner of motion bar 51 is interior and plugging block is in cylindrical cavity 22, motion bar 51 Diameter is less than runner and arrived, i.e., communicated all the time between the inner chamber of sleeve 20 and cylindrical cavity 22, second back-moving spring 52 is set with Outside motion bar 51 and between plugging block and fixed flange 23, wherein, plugging block includes the first disk 53, the second disk 54 And the center connecting pole 55 of the first disk 53 of connection and the second disk 54, at center, connecting pole outer sheath is equipped with sealing ring, activity The bottom of bar 51 is fixedly connected with the center of the first disk 53, and the external diameter of the first disk 53 is greater than the external diameter of the second disk 54, Flange 56 is kept out in the bottom of annular inner wall 21 provided with radially inwardly projecting second, and the external diameter of the first disk 53 keeps out convex more than second The internal diameter of edge 56, the external diameter of the second disk 54 is less than the second internal diameter for keeping out flange 56, so that, the second disk 54 can be from second A protruding segment distance at flange 56 is kept out, the first disk 53 then keeps out flange 56 by second and supports limitation.
Under the effect of no external structure, second back-moving spring 52 promotes plugging block to be moved to second and keeps out convex by elastic force At edge 56, the first disk 53 and sealing ring in plugging block are kept out flange 56 with second and are in close contact, so as to cylindrical cavity 22 Blocked.When there is the effect of external structure, plugging block is promoted and overcomes the elastic force of second back-moving spring 52 inwardly to move Dynamic, plugging block departs from second and keeps out flange 56, and now, cylindrical cavity 22 is communicated with outside.
Preferably, the top of sleeve 20, which is fastened and connected, buckle closure 24, the top two side of sleeve 20, which is symmetrically respectively formed with, buckles Block 25, the both sides of edges end of buckle closure 24 correspondence forms the button hole 26 fastened with button block 25 respectively, and array distribution is formed on buckle closure 24 There is the through hole of the connection inner chamber of sleeve 20 and annular flow inner chamber 30, by being fastened and connected for button block 25 and button hole 26, can facilitate Ground dismounts buckle closure 24, so that convenient change to filter material therein.
Preferably, circumferentially spaced on the outer wall of sleeve 20 be provided with multiple positioning convex strips 27, in positioning convex strip In the presence of 27 so that the stable center position in filter cylinder 10 of sleeve 20, sleeve 20 can be effectively prevented from and moved.
